Abstract

The development of educational technology requires universities to adopt an adaptive and student-centered learning approach. However, the implementation of a deep learning approach in the learning process still faces various obstacles, such as limited lecturer understanding, a lack of implementation strategies, and suboptimal technology integration in teaching and learning activities. This community service activity aims to improve lecturers' competency in designing and implementing deep learning-based adaptive strategies to support the quality of learning at Muhammadiyah University of Palembang. The methods used include socialization, training, intensive mentoring, and evaluation. The training focused on understanding the concept of deep learning, designing adaptive learning, and utilizing supporting technology. Next, mentoring was provided in the development of learning tools and their implementation in the classroom. Evaluation was carried out through observation, questionnaires, and analysis of learning quality improvements. The results of the activity showed an increase in lecturers' understanding and skills in developing deep learning-based learning strategies. In addition, there was an increase in active student participation, critical thinking skills, and the quality of learning interactions. Lecturers were also able to integrate technology more effectively into the learning process. The conclusion of this activity is that mentoring with deep learning-based adaptive strategies is effective in improving the quality of learning in higher education. This program is recommended to be implemented sustainably with the support of institutional policies to achieve more optimal improvements in the quality of education.
